Responsibilities
- Preparing and re-marketing submissions
- Negotiating coverage details with underwriters
- Cross-selling
- Direct bill and premium financing
- Review policies and endorsements for accuracy
- Process requested changes in coverage
- Answer client questions
- Issue certificates of insurance
- Issue auto ID cards
- Assist in the coordination of loss control and claims support
